What Is Keratosis Pilaris (Also Known As Chicken Skin)?

Keratosis pilaris, also known as chicken skin, is the official medical term for a harmless, but annoying genetic disorder that leaves some of us with small bumps on our skin, oftentimes on the outer upper arms and thighs. It can also sometimes affect the buttocks and even face, a place you’ll often spot it on children.
